The Blue Ridge Scenic Railway operates out of Blue Ridge Georgia.
The train route consists of a 26-mile round trip through historic Murphy Junction along the beautiful Toccoa River. Built over 100 years ago, the railroad is the only mainline railroad excursion service based in Georgia.
Catherhine Hill Bay on the Nsw Australian east coast, once was a thriving coal mine town with an impressive coal loading facility. The coal mines have since closed and the coal loading wharf now sits abandoned.
The Santa Maria Cruiser is a comfortable way to cruise among the limestone-karst peaks of Halong Bay. It is 29 meters long, 7 meters wide, and decked out in teak and oak in the traditional Asian Junk style.
A beautiful sanctuary in northern Vietnam in the Gulf of Tonkin, comprised of a 120km coastline and over 1500 islands dotting the landscape. A 434km zone is recognized by UNESCO as a world natural heritage site.
Craggy Gardens is one of the most beautiful stops along the Blue Ridge Parkway. In summer, rhododendrons and other wildflowers cover the land with vivid color--one of the brightest displays along the parkway.
